sdhci: Add quirk for controllers that need small delays for PIO

Small udelay is needed to make eSDHC work in PIO mode. Without
the delay reading causes endless interrupt storm, and writing
corrupts data. The first guess would be that we must wait for
some bit in some register, but I didn't find any reliable bits
that change before and after the delay.
